Maine Camp Experience (MCE) is a strong community—a network of more than 35 overnight summer camps throughout Maine with a trademarked Campcierge camp-planning resource to help families choose their best camp.
“Every MCE member camp is set on a beautiful lake and has incredible directors, facilities, activities, instruction, trips and more,” says Director Laurie Kaiden. “Steeped in tradition, many of our camps have run for over 100 years, including safely and successfully amidst the pandemic in the summers of 2020 and 2021.”
With a focus on Maine’s natural beauty, camps blend arts, sports and nature activities with trips to places like Boothbay Harbor and Acadia National Park. Some 20,000 campers ages 7-17 sign up yearly for sessions that range from two weeks to two months.
